## v2.8.0 — Proctor Queue Changes

The ExamGate proctoring queue now drains candidates in strict submission order; plugins can no longer reorder entries via the priority hook. The `onQueueAdvance` callback fires once per candidate instead of per retry, so update any counters accordingly. Deprecated `peekNext()` will be removed in v3.0. Plugin authors should test against the staging queue before the next certification window. Direct all queue-behavior questions to the maintainer named below.

named custodian: Brivan Eliath Quenox Frador

**Vendor note: Inkmill markdown pipeline**

Rendering for Parchway docs is outsourced to Inkmill under an annual contract, renewing each March. They handle sanitization and PDF export; we own the upload queue. SLA: 4-hour response on rendering failures. Escalate only after two failed retries. Their support desk is reachable at the address below.

billing contact of hahaf-baguf = zorael.tammir.jorius@sivrelhq.internal

# This file drives the watering-schedule service for the Fernbrook deployment.
# Ordering matters for the bootstrap script: database settings first, then
# sensor-hub endpoints, then feature flags, then credentials last.
# Do not reuse values between staging and production; each environment has
# its own credential issued by the irrigation-control gateway.
# Rotate quarterly per the release checklist. The credentials section begins
# directly below, starting with the line that authorizes scheduler writes to
# the valve controller, which is:

vault entry, bagep-yahip: VAULT_KEY8=d2a227e5

**Changelog — KioskPilot watchdog defaults**

Heads up for the sync: we changed the watchdog defaults on the BreezeKiosk app after the lobby units at the Farrowgate pilot kept restarting mid-checkout. The restart backoff now doubles instead of firing flat every 30s, and the heartbeat grace window is wider so slow boots don't trip it. Nobody should need to touch per-device overrides anymore — the fleet picks these up on next check-in. For reference, the new default configuration the watchdog ships with is as follows.

settings of bafof-fajog:
[aldix]
port = 9300
region = north-3
host = aldix.kelvilabs.example
team = istath
timeout_ms = 1500
retries = 8